What Are U Shaped Valleys?

A U-shaped valley is a geological formation with high, steep sides and a flat or rounded valley bottom. These valleys are created by glaciation. They are often filled with lakes or rivers, sandtraps along a golf course kettle lakes (water hazards) or other natural features.

merax-modern-large-u-shape-sectional-sofGlacial erosion forms U-shaped valleys as rocks are removed from the sides and bottom of the valley. These valleys can be found in mountainous regions across the globe.

They are created by glaciers.

Glaciers are massive masses of ice that form and slide down mountains. When they degrade the landscape, they create U-shaped valleys with flat floors and steep sides. These are different from the river valleys, which typically have the shape of an X. Although glacial erosion can occur anywhere however, these valleys tend be more prevalent in mountainous areas. They are so distinct that you can determine if the landscape was shaped by glaciers or rivers.

The formation of a U-shaped valley starts with an existing V-shaped river valley. As the glacier erodes, it encroaches upon the V-shaped valley of the river and creates a U-shaped inverted shape. The ice also damages the surface of the land, causing the valley's sides to have high and straight walls. This process is known as glaciation, and it requires the strength of a lot to scour the earth this manner.

As the glacier continues to degrade the landscape, it makes the valley wider and deeper. The glacier's ice is less abrasive than the rocks. As the glacier moves through the valley, it also causes abrasion of the surfaces of the rocks. This pulls the weaker rocks away from the valley walls, a process known as plucking. These processes work together to smooth, widen and deepen the U-shaped valley.

These processes also cause a tiny side valley to hang over the main valley. This valley is often filled with ribbon lakes, which are created by water rushing through the glacier. The valley is also marked by striations and ruts on the sides and the floor, as also moraines and till on the floor.

U-shaped valleys are found all over the world. They are common in mountainous areas, including the Andes, Alps, Caucasus, Himalaya and Rocky Mountains. In the United States, they are typically found in national parks. Examples include Glacier National Park and the Nant Ffrancon Valley in Wales. In certain instances valleys can extend to the ocean and transform into fjords. This is a natural phenomenon that occurs when the glacier melts. It can take thousands of years to build these valleys.

U-shaped valleys are characterized by their wide bases, unlike V-shaped ones. Glaciers are the primary cause of these valleys, which are generally found in mountain ranges. Glaciers are massive blocks made of snow and ice that erode the landscape as they move downhill. They erode valleys through friction and erosion. This is referred to as scouring. As they degrade the landscape, glaciers create an unusual shape that resembles an u shaped couch-shaped letter. These are referred to as U-shaped valleys. They can be located in many places around the world.

These valleys form when glaciers erode the valleys of rivers. The glacier's slow movement and weight degrades the valley sides and floor creating a distinct U shape. This process is known as glacial erosion, and has led to some of the most stunning landscapes on Earth.

These valleys are also called trough valleys or glacial troughs. They are found throughout the world, particularly in areas that have glaciers and mountains. They can range in size from a few meters to several hundred kilometers. They can also vary in depth and length. The temperature fluctuation will be higher the deeper the valley.

If a U-shaped gorge is filled with water, it creates a ribbon lake or fjord. The ribbon lakes are formed in the depressions in which the glacier has eroded the less resistant rock. They can also form within valleys, where the glacier has been stopped by the wall.

U-shaped valleys can also contain other glacial features, such as moraine dams, hanging valleys and erratics. Erratics, which are massive boulders, are deposited by glaciers as the latter moves. They can be used to mark the boundaries between glaciated areas.

Hanging valleys are smaller side valleys that are left 'hanging' above the main valley created by the glacier. These valleys are not as deep than the main valley and they are ice-free. These valleys are cut by tributary ice and are typically overshadowed by waterfalls.
